Remembering Bunker Hill: 250 Years Later
Today—the 17th of June 2025—marks the 250th anniversary of the Battle of Bunker Hill. The battle started when Colonel William Prescott led 1,200 men onto the Charlestown peninsula in Massachusetts to erect defenses on Bunker Hill in defense against British plans to capture undefended high ground at Dorchester Heights and Charlestown.
